Page 1 of 1
[IHM Geral] Manipulando endereços Modbus na MMI700
Posted: Wed Sep 27, 2017 11:31 am
by Paulo.Inazumi
Irei utilizar uma MMI700 configurada como escravo (Modbus RTU) para exibir alarmes de uma lista de endereços Holding Registers.
1 - Como manipular e configurar os endereços para leitura na MMI700 ?
2 - Cada palavra de 16 bits irá contemplar 2 bits (um para alarme e um para status) - Como configurar uma tela para que seja mostrada automaticamente quando houver um alarme oriundo do bit desta palavra ?
Re: Manipulando endereços Modbus na MMI700
Posted: Wed Sep 27, 2017 12:20 pm
by Paulo.Inazumi
Prezado bom dia !
Seguem respostas aos seus questionamentos:
1 - Como manipular e configurar os endereços para leitura na MMI700 ?
R: Na árvore de projeto da MMI700, selecione o item "modelo" e na opção "Protocolo" selecione "MODBUS-RTU".
- mmi700_mdb.PNG
- mmi700_mdb.PNG (14.05 KiB) Viewed 4777 times
Na criação dos tags, para mapeamento das variáveis do seu dispositivo remoto em modbus:
* a opção "integer16" corresponde aos registros do tipo "Holding Register" do seu dispositivo remoto
* a opção "logic" corresponde aos registros do tipo "Coil" do seu dispositivo remoto
- mmi700_holdreg.PNG
- mmi700_holdreg.PNG (6.37 KiB) Viewed 4774 times
2 - Cada palavra de 16 bits irá contemplar 2 bits (um para alarme e um para status) - Como configurar uma tela para que seja mostrada automaticamente quando houver um alarme oriundo do bit desta palavra ?
R: Existem várias opções para realizar este tratamento. Uma opção inicial seria criar um timer para monitorar alteração desta variável, e o seu respectivo tratamento executar uma ação para abertura de uma tela onde será apresentado o alarme.
Atenciosamente,
Paulo Inazumi
Equipe de Suporte Técnico da HI Tecnologia.